Anonim

Jika Anda pernah menggunakan Github sebelumnya, Anda tahu bahwa itu tidak segera jelas tentang cara mengunduh file dari platform. Ini adalah salah satu platform yang lebih rumit, karena tidak secara langsung dimaksudkan untuk berbagi file langsung, tetapi untuk pengembangan. Memang, salah satu hal besar tentang Github adalah bahwa semua repositori publik adalah open source, dan orang-orang didorong untuk berkontribusi - ada repositori pribadi, tetapi ini umumnya digunakan untuk tujuan pengembangan dalam bisnis yang tidak ingin kode mereka terlihat oleh publik. Github, bagaimanapun, masih menangani pengunduhan file secara berbeda dari tempat lain.

Jadi, jika Anda tidak sepenuhnya yakin cara mengunduh file dari proyek (atau seluruh proyek) dari Github, kami akan menunjukkan caranya. Mari kita mulai.

Mengunduh file

Sebagian besar repositori publik dapat diunduh secara gratis, bahkan tanpa akun pengguna. Ini karena repositori publik dianggap sebagai basis kode yang bersifat open source. Yang mengatakan, kecuali pemilik basis kode memeriksa kotak sebaliknya, basis kode mereka dapat diunduh ke komputer Anda, dikemas ke dalam file .zip.

Jadi, jika Anda pergi ke basis kode publik - seperti Tip Calculator yang saya buat ini - Anda akan melihat bahwa di sudut kanan atas adalah tombol hijau yang mengatakan Clone atau Download . Klik pada tombol, dan kemudian di dropdown, pilih Unduh ZIP . Semua file akan mulai diunduh ke komputer Anda, biasanya di folder Unduhan Anda.

Lalu, buka folder Unduhan di komputer Anda dan temukan file ZIP. Anda akan ingin mengklik kanan dan memilih opsi yang mengatakan "Unzip" atau "Uncompress", dan kemudian pilih folder di mana Anda ingin file berakhir.

Terakhir, navigasikan ke folder yang dipilih, dan Anda akan menemukan semua file Github yang kami unduh di sana!

Itu basis kode yang cukup kecil, dengan hanya beberapa file di dalamnya. Jika Anda masuk ke repositori 30 JavaScript Wes Bos di Github, Anda akan melihat bahwa - karena ini adalah repositori publik - ini dapat diunduh dengan cara yang sama.

Ada cara yang lebih baik untuk "mengunduh" file

Meskipun cara yang kami uraikan sederhana dan mudah, itu paling optimal untuk hanya melihat file kode, bukan bereksperimen. Jika Anda berencana mengunduh file Github untuk bereksperimen, cara terbaik adalah "bercabang" dengan proyek tersebut. Garpu hanyalah salinan repositori Anda sendiri.

Forking repositori dilengkapi dengan sejumlah manfaat. Ini memberi Anda salinan Anda sendiri di akun Github Anda yang memungkinkan Anda untuk secara bebas bereksperimen dengan perubahan tanpa mempengaruhi proyek asli. Misalnya, Anda dapat menemukan bug di Tip Calculator saya atau ingin menambahkan fitur Anda sendiri. Jadi, Anda bisa "bercabang" dengan Tip Calculator saya, membuat salinan di akun Github Anda. Di sini, Anda dapat mengacaukan kode dan bereksperimen dengannya tanpa memengaruhi proyek asli, karena ini akan menjadi salinan atau “garpu” Anda. Paling umum, garpu digunakan untuk mengajukan perubahan pada proyek orang lain, seperti memperbaiki bug atau menambahkan fitur seperti yang kami sebutkan.

Jadi, bagaimana Anda membayar repositori publik? Ini sebenarnya cukup mudah. Sebelum memulai, Anda perlu membuat akun Github gratis, karena Anda perlu tempat untuk menyimpan garpu. Anda dapat mengunjungi www.github.com dan melakukan ini sekarang.

Setelah akun Anda dibuat, Anda dapat melakukan repositori publik ke akun Anda. Sebagai contoh, Anda dapat menuju ke gudang umum untuk kursus pelatihan JavaScript 30 Hari Wes Bos, dan di sudut kanan atas, Anda akan melihat tombol bertuliskan Fork. Klik tombolnya.

Mungkin butuh beberapa detik hingga beberapa menit, tetapi Github kemudian akan mengkloning atau "bercabang" proyek itu ke akun GitHub Anda sendiri. Setelah selesai, ia akan segera menampilkan proyek di bawah nama pengguna Github Anda. Untuk memverifikasi, Anda dapat mengklik ikon profil Anda di bilah navigasi di kanan atas, dan kemudian pilih opsi yang mengatakan Repositori Anda . Dalam daftar repositori Anda, Anda harus melihat basis kode kursus JavaScript 30.

Sekarang, Anda dapat mengubah dan bereksperimen dengan kode yang Anda inginkan, dan itu tidak akan memengaruhi file proyek asli dari pemilik asli. Jika Anda mengubah beberapa kode, memperbaiki bug, atau menambahkan fitur baru, Anda dapat membuat sesuatu yang disebut "Tarik Permintaan, " di mana perubahan itu dapat didiskusikan. Jika pemilik proyek asli menyukai perubahan - dan berfungsi dengan baik - itu dapat digabungkan ke dalam basis kode asli sebagai kode produksi.

Penutupan

Seperti yang Anda lihat, mengunduh file dan seluruh proyek dari Github sebenarnya cukup mudah. Hanya dalam beberapa menit, Anda dapat memiliki seluruh proyek diunduh ke komputer Anda, atau bahkan bercabang ke akun Github Anda sendiri. Tidak perlu banyak dipusingkan dengan kode di garpu Anda untuk melihat apa yang memengaruhi apa, dan akhirnya, Anda mungkin bisa membuat permintaan tarikan pertama Anda! Selamat coding!

Cara mengunduh file dari github